Output 3ab2bd86c6e27d4173af25e3248feb955dc4bd3521dad98809a26523e38e8731:0

value
1016207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2388893564e55bbf1eb7b23c1c156104b2b2b28d OP_EQUAL
address
34vu8wfqL74kekPJPP4eWHhU2U1HG2xHCb
transaction
3ab2bd86c6e27d4173af25e3248feb955dc4bd3521dad98809a26523e38e8731
spent
true